What Beehive does

Beehive is the calm, offline logbook every backyard beekeeper deserves. Add each hive once — name, location, install date, queen year — then record inspections in seconds: queen seen, brood pattern, temperament, stores, varroa notes, and any treatments applied. A timeline view shows exactly how each colony has changed over the season.

Log honey harvests with date and weight; Beehive tallies your season total and per-hive yield automatically. Set inspection reminders so no colony goes unchecked too long.

No internet, no account, no fees for the essentials. Your apiary diary lives entirely on your phone.

What's inside

  • Inspection log — Structured per-inspection form capturing queen seen, brood pattern score, temperament, stores level, varroa count, treatments applied, and free-form notes. Each entry stamped with date and duration.
  • Harvest tracker — Record each honey pull with date and weight in kg or lb; Beehive accumulates a running season total and shows a per-hive yield list.
  • Apiary home — Card list of all hives showing name, last-inspection date, inspection-due indicator, and this-season harvest weight at a glance.
  • Inspection reminders — Per-hive local notifications set to fire 7, 10, or 14 days after the last inspection, configurable from hive settings.

Why we built it

Backyard beekeepers record inspections on paper cards, spreadsheets, or memory, making it easy to miss treatment windows, forget what last week's queen check showed, and lose an entire season of harvest data when a notebook is misplaced.
